This is an exceptionally rare Victorian thimble. It is made of wood, looks like walnut. It is in the shape of a sewing basket. The really neat thing about this, is that it actually unscrews and opens up. It would hold thread & needles etc...It is beautifully handcrafted and in primo condition. What they did in the Victorian times before thimbles that we know of today is: push the needle, (which was usually going through some pretty thick material back then,) through by pushing up against this wooden object , known as a thimble. it is aprox just under 3 inches in height.
